The Village now operates five distinct external contact pipelines, each with fundamentally different resolution characteristics: (1) Email quarantine — daily staff review, reliable throughput, 18/25 timing score; (2) GitLab issues channels — agent-managed, near-instant, human-consented (Nervli model); (3) Helper/help@ queue — frozen 5+ days, no confirmed resolution, requires workarounds; (4) Twitter DMs — platform-dependent, variable latency, follower-gated; (5) Substack comments — human-initiated, high signal, research-tier engagement. The diversity of pipelines represents an evolutionary adaptation — agents built around blocked channels rather than waiting for them to open.
